A major traffic violation is a more serious traffic offense. Driving while intoxicated, reckless driving, and driving with a revoked license are all major violations.

A 16028C VC violation refers to California Vehicle Code Section 16028, which mandates that drivers must provide proof of financial responsibility (insurance) when requested by law enforcement. A violation occurs when a driver fails to present valid proof of insurance during a traffic stop or an accident investigation. This infraction can result in fines and potential penalties, including points on the driver's record.
